XRP Price Stuck Despite $8M Fund Inflows
The XRP price has not budged from $1.11 despite significant inflows into U.S.-listed spot funds, which saw a combined total of $8.15 million flow in between July 20 and July 24.
This influx arrived across just two trading days, with Bitwise contributing $2.49 million on July 20 and Franklin Templeton's XRPZ fund following with $5.66 million the next session.
The inflows are notable, but they amount to only about 1.46% of XRP's market capitalization, a figure that suggests these flows may not be enough to move the price.
Moreover, analysts see this as a last gasp of institutional demand, with July's inflows marking the weakest month since April and representing a significant drop from previous months.
